Break-Glass Access — Tumblebin Locker Flow

This page covers emergency access to the Tumblebin laundry-locker system when the normal access service is down. The standard flow issues one-time codes through the resident app; break-glass bypasses that and opens the maintenance panel directly. Use this only when the Harwick ops lead has confirmed an outage, and log every use in the access ledger within one hour. To authenticate against the offline maintenance panel, enter the passphrase below.

unlock words, yawig-kagef: gordor-holvan-ulaael-pramir-ulaiel-tamdor

Subject: Partner SFTP drop — new owner

Hi,

As you review the pending changes to the Harborline ingest scripts, note that ownership of the partner SFTP drop is changing at the end of the month. This includes key rotation, the nightly pull job, and the quarantine folder for malformed files. Review comments on the retry logic should still go through the normal PR flow, but questions about drop-folder conventions or partner onboarding now go to the new owner. The incoming owner is listed below.

signatory, tagaf-bahaf: Praael Fenmir Rusok

## Deployment

The Slatebell timetable solver ships as a single container. Build with the included Makefile, push to the internal registry, and deploy via the Corven orchestrator; one replica per school district is sufficient. Solver runs are idempotent, so restarts are safe. On startup the service reads the configuration values listed below.

config for bagep-kageg:
ULADOR_LOG_LEVEL=warn
ULADOR_METRICS_HOST=metrics.ulador.tolvaqcorp.corp
ULADOR_POOL_SIZE=32

Subject: Tile cache ownership shuffle

Hey folks, quick heads-up before the sync: the tile-rendering cache layer in Mapwright is changing hands. With the Quillhaven basemap launch behind us, we're moving ownership off the platform squad so they can focus on vector styling. The new owner will handle eviction tuning, the warm-up scripts, and the dreaded cache-stampede alerts. Please route cache questions accordingly starting Monday. For clarity at this week's sync, here's who's taking point on the cache layer going forward.

named custodian: Belius Casath Ulaix Sorius